Projetive TecnologiaSuporte

CT5 - Lançamento Padrão

Abas

OrdemDescrição
1Cadastro
2Entidades
3Valores
4Historico

Campos

NomeTamanhoTipoTítuloDescriçãoValidaçãoHelp
CT5_FILIAL2CFilialFilial do Sistema
Filial do SIstema.
CT5_LANPAD3CCod Lanc PadCodigo Lancamento PadraoExistChav("CT5",m->ct5_lanpad+m->ct5_sequen,1) .And. FreeForUse("CT5",m->ct5_lanpad+m->ct5_sequen)
Indica o código do lançamento padronizado. Cada processo do Advanced Protheus possui o seu próprio código.
CT5_STATUS1CStatusStatus do LancamentoPertence("12 ")
Indica se o lançamento padrão esta ativo ou inativo, evitando assim a necessidade de se excluir o lançamento padrão quando o mesmo não deve ser executado.
CT5_SEQUEN3CSequencialSequencial Lcto PadraoExistChav("CT5",m->ct5_lanpad+m->ct5_sequen,1).And. FreeForUse("CT5",m->ct5_lanpad+m->ct5_sequen).And.IsNumeric(m->ct5_sequen)
Indica o número da linha do lançamento padronizado. Cada uma destas linhas irá gerar uma linha de lançamento contábil.
CT5_DESC40CDescricaoDescricao do Lcto Padrao
Informa a descrição do lançamento padronizado. Poderá ser utilizado para indicar o uso do lançamento-padrão ou qual o processo gerador do lançamento.
CT5_DC1CTipo LctoTipo do LancamentoPertence("1234")
CT5_DEBITO200CCta DebitoConta DebitoVazio() .Or. Ctb080Form() .And. CTB93VCA()
Informa a conta contábil para débito ou uma expressão ADVPL. Tecle [F3] para selecionar uma Conta Contábil já cadastrada.
CT5_CREDIT200CCta CreditoConta CreditoVazio() .Or. Ctb080Form() .And. CTB93VCA()
Informa a conta contábil para crédito ou uma expressão ADVPL. Tecle [F3] para selecionar uma Conta Contábil já cadastrada.
CT5_MOEDAS5CLcto MoedasLancamento nas MoedasCtb080CDB()
Informa para quais moedas deverão ser efetuados lançamentos contábeis. Poderá ser preenchido com: 1 - Efetua o lançamento na Moeda 2 - Não efetua o lançamento. Cada “1” ou “2” representa uma moeda em uso pelo sistema. Ex: Se o campo for preenchido com “11211”, somente na moeda 3 não será efetuado o lançamento contábil OBS Se forem utilizadas mais que 5 moedas, haverá a necessidade de alterar o tamanho deste campo no Configurador.
CT5_VLR01200CVlr Moeda 1Valor na Moeda 1Vazio() .Or. Ctb080Form() .And. CTB93VCA()
Informa os respectivos valores das moedas para os lançamentos contábeis ou uma expressão ADVPL. Ex: SE1->E1_VALLIQ ou SE2->E2_VALOR - SE2->E2_IRRF O lançamento contábil só será efetuado se pelo menos um dos valores nas Moedas existentes for diferente de zero. Se não for informado nenhum conteúdo para um campo de Valor (com exceção da Moeda 1), o SIGACTB irá automaticamente converter o valor tomando como base o Critério de Conversão e o Cadastro de Moedas. Para maiores detalhes vide “Lançamentos Contábeis”. Se forem utilizadas mais que 5 moedas, haverá a necessidade de criar os campos de valor respectivos no Configurador.
CT5_VLR02200CVlr Moeda 2Valor na Moeda 2Vazio() .Or. Ctb080Form() .And. CTB93VCA()
Informa os respectivos valores das moedas para os lançamentos contábeis ou uma expressão ADVPL. Ex: SE1->E1_VALLIQ ou SE2->E2_VALOR - SE2->E2_IRRF O lançamento contábil só será efetuado se pelo menos um dos valores nas Moedas existentes for diferente de zero. Se não for informado nenhum conteúdo para um campo de Valor (com exceção da Moeda 1), o SIGACTB irá automaticamente converter o valor tomando como base o Critério de Conversão e o Cadastro de Moedas. Para maiores detalhes vide “Lançamentos Contábeis”. Se forem utilizadas mais que 5 moedas, haverá a necessidade de criar os campos de valor respectivos no Configurador.
CT5_VLR03200CVlr Moeda 3Valor na Moeda 3Vazio() .Or. Ctb080Form() .And. CTB93VCA()
Informa os respectivos valores das moedas para os lançamentos contábeis ou uma expressão ADVPL. Ex: SE1->E1_VALLIQ ou SE2->E2_VALOR - SE2->E2_IRRF O lançamento contábil só será efetuado se pelo menos um dos valores nas Moedas existentes for diferente de zero. Se não for informado nenhum conteúdo para um campo de Valor (com exceção da Moeda 1), o SIGACTB irá automaticamente converter o valor tomando como base o Critério de Conversão e o Cadastro de Moedas. Para maiores detalhes vide “Lançamentos Contábeis”. Se forem utilizadas mais que 5 moedas, haverá a necessidade de criar os campos de valor respectivos no Configurador.
CT5_VLR04200CVlr Moeda 4Valor na Moeda 4Vazio() .Or. Ctb080Form() .And. CTB93VCA()
Informa os respectivos valores das moedas para os lançamentos contábeis ou uma expressão ADVPL. Ex: SE1->E1_VALLIQ ou SE2->E2_VALOR - SE2->E2_IRRF O lançamento contábil só será efetuado se pelo menos um dos valores nas Moedas existentes for diferente de zero. Se não for informado nenhum conteúdo para um campo de Valor (com exceção da Moeda 1), o SIGACTB irá automaticamente converter o valor tomando como base o Critério de Conversão e o Cadastro de Moedas. Para maiores detalhes vide “Lançamentos Contábeis”. Se forem utilizadas mais que 5 moedas, haverá a necessidade de criar os campos de valor respectivos no Configurador.
CT5_VLR05200CVlr Moeda 5Valor na Moeda 5Vazio() .Or. Ctb080Form() .And. CTB93VCA()
Informa os respectivos valores das moedas para os lançamentos contábeis ou uma expressão ADVPL. Ex: SE1->E1_VALLIQ ou SE2->E2_VALOR - SE2->E2_IRRF O lançamento contábil só será efetuado se pelo menos um dos valores nas Moedas existentes for diferente de zero. Se não for informado nenhum conteúdo para um campo de Valor (com exceção da Moeda 1), o SIGACTB irá automaticamente converter o valor tomando como base o Critério de Conversão e o Cadastro de Moedas. Para maiores detalhes vide “Lançamentos Contábeis”. Se forem utilizadas mais que 5 moedas, haverá a necessidade de criar os campos de valor respectivos no Configurador.
CT5_HIST200CHistoricoHistorico LanctoVazio() .Or. Ctb080Form()
Indica o Histórico do Lançamento Contábil. Informe um texto entre aspas ou uma expressão ADVPL.
CT5_HAGLUT200CHist AglutHistorico AglutinadoVazio() .Or. Ctb080Form()
Indica o Histórico do Lançamento Aglutinado. Informe um texto entre aspas ou uma expressão ADVPL Se este campo for preenchido e o Lançamento Contábil for aglutinado, será este o histórico a ser gravado no Lançamento Contábil.
CT5_CCD200CC Custo DebCentro de Custo DebitoVazio() .Or. (Ctb080Form() .And. Ctb080CC()) .And. CTB93VCA()
Indica o Centro de Custo a ser debitado no lançamento. Poderá ser informado o código ou uma expressão ADVPL. Tecle [F3] para selecionar um Centro de Custo já cadastrado.
CT5_CCC200CC Custo CredCentro de Custo CreditoVazio() .Or. (Ctb080Form() .And. Ctb080CC()) .And. CTB93VCA()
Indica o Centro de Custo a ser Creditado no lançamento. Poderá ser informado o código ou uma expressão ADVPL. Tecle [F3] para selecionar um Centro de Custo já cadastrado.
CT5_ORIGEM100COrigem LctoOrigem do LanctoVazio() .Or. Ctb080Form()
Este campo identifica a origem do lançamento contábil. Poderá ser um texto ou expressao ADVPL, Este campo visa a idenficação posterior no módulo SIGACTB seguindo critérios do usuário.
CT5_INTERC1CInterCompanyEh Lcto IntercompanyPertence("12 ")
Indicativo de lançamento Intercompany.
CT5_ITEMD200CItem DebitoItem DebitoVazio() .Or. Ctb080Form() .And. CTB93VCA()
Indica o Item Contábil a ser debitado no lançamento. Poderá ser informado o código ou uma expressão ADVPL. Tecle [F3] para selecionar um Item Contábil já cadastrado.
CT5_ITEMC200CItem CreditoItem CreditoVazio() .Or. Ctb080Form() .And. CTB93VCA()
Indica o Item Contábil a ser Creditado no lançamento. Poderá ser informado o código ou uma expressão ADVPL. Tecle [F3] para selecionar um Item Contábil já cadastrado.
CT5_CLVLDB200CCl Vlr DebClasse Valor DebitoVazio() .Or. Ctb080Form() .And. CTB93VCA()
Indica a Classe de Valor a ser debitada no lançamento. Poderá ser informado o código ou uma expressão ADVPL. Tecle [F3] para selecionar uma Classe de Valor já cadastrada.
CT5_CLVLCR200CCl Vlr CrdClasse Valor CreditoVazio() .Or. Ctb080Form() .And. CTB93VCA()
Indica a Classe de Valor a ser Creditada no lançamento. Poderá ser informado o código ou uma expressão ADVPL. Tecle [F3] para selecionar uma Classe de Valor já cadastrada.
CT5_ATIVDE200COutr Inf DebOutras Inf. Debito
Campo para outras informações. Uso livre pelo usuário.
CT5_ATIVCR200COutr Inf CrdOutras Inf. Credito
Campo para outras informações. Uso livre pelo usuário.
CT5_TPSALD1CTipo do SLDTipo do SaldoExistCpo("SX5","SL"+M->CT5_TPSALD)
Tipo do saldo Contábil. Utilize [F3] para escolher.
CT5_MOEDLC2CMoeda LctoMoeda do Lancamento
Campo indicador da moeda original do lançamento contábil.
CT5_SBLOTE3CSub-LoteSub-LoteExistCpo("SX5", "SB" + M->CT5_SBLOTE)
Indica o Sub-Lote a ser gerado no lançamento contábil. Tecle [F3] para acessar a Tabela de Sub-Lotes Campo é bloqueado a menos que o parâmetro MV_SUBLOTE esteja em branco para permitir a seleção do lote desejado. Se não é realizado automaticamente conforme validações do sistema.
CT5_ROTRAS60CRot.RastrearRotina Vis. Rastreamento
Função a ser executada na visualização do rastreamento de lançamentos. O campo tem prioridade na execução do rastreamento sobre a função do cadastro de relacionamentos (CTL). Caso não esteja criado ou esteja em branco, será verificado o cadastro de relacionamentos (CTL), buscando a rotina a executar e, caso o cadastro de relacionamentos não esteja configurado ou sem rotina para visualização, será apresentado o modelo padrão de cadastro para a visualização de registros (AxVisual).
CT5_TABORI100CTabela Orig.Tabela de Origem Lancto.
Preenchimento opcional. Se habilitado e preenchido deve conter o nome (alias) da tabela de origem do lançamento contábil. Em casos onde houver campo correspondente à flag de contabilização (_DTLANC, _LA), deve ser indicado o nome (alias) da tabela que contém o campo ?flag? de contabilização. Se mantido em branco assume função padrão RetRecnoLP().
CT5_DTVENC200CData VencData Vencimento
Indica uma data que poderá ser utilizada de acordo com as necessidades do usuário. Poderá ser informado o código ou uma expressão ADVPL.
CT5_RECORI100CReg. OrigemFuncao Reg. na Tab.Origem
Preenchimento opcional. Se habilitado e preenchido deve conter função / coluna que corresponda ao identificador de registro (recno) da tabela de origem do lançamento padronizado. Se mantido em branco assume função padrão RetRecnoLP().
CT5_CVKVER8CVersao OrigVersao Original
Codigo atribuido pelo campo CVK_VERSAO da tabela de Carga de Lançamento Padrão - CVK para validações internas no sistema.
CT5_CVKSEQ3CSeq originalSeq original
Codigo sequencial atribuido pelo campo CVK_SEQUEN da tabela de Carga de Lançamento padrao - CVK para validações internas no sistema.
CT5_MLTSLD20CTps SaldosTps Saldos
Armazena os multiplos saldos
CT5_CODPAR6CCod.Partic.Codigo do ParticipanteExistCPO("CVC")
Informar o Código do Participante. Na maioria dos casos este código não será necessário, mas há situações específicas que o exigem no Lançamento Contábil. Será utilizado no SPED Contábil.
CT5_DIACTB50CCod DiarioCod Diario ContabilidadeCtb080Form()
informe o código do Diario Contábil para Controle Sequencial.
CT5_AT01DB100CAtiv.01 DBAtividade 01 DB
Informar a Atividade Complementar 1 a Debito
CT5_AT01CR100CAtiv.01 CRAtividade 01 CR
Informar a Atividade Complementar 1 a Credito
CT5_AT02DB100CAtiv.02 DBAtividade 02 DB
Informar a Atividade Complementar 2 a Debito
CT5_AT02CR100CAtiv.02 CRAtividade 02 CR
Informar a Atividade Complementar 2 a Credito
CT5_AT03DB100CAtiv.03 DBAtividade 03 DB
Informar a Atividade Complementar 3 a Debito
CT5_AT03CR100CAtiv.03 CRAtividade 03 CR
Informar a Atividade Complementar 3 a Credito
CT5_AT04DB100CAtiv.04 DBAtividade 04 DB
Informar a Atividade Complementar 4 a Debito
CT5_AT04CR100CAtiv.04 CRAtividade 04 CR
Informar a Atividade Complementar 4 a Credito
CT5_CTRLSD1CControl.SaldControl. Saldos
Indica se ao executar este lançamento padrão, o sistema contábil terá que replicar os dados para outro tipo de saldo contábil.
CT5_CODCLI200CCód. ClienteCódigo do ClienteVazio() .Or. Ctb080Form()
Informe o codigo do cliente Apenas para vinculo e informação. Campo mantido por compatibilidade, descontinuado não é mais utilizado nos demais módulos.
CT5_MOEFDB100CMoed fato DBMoeda do fato p/ a ent DBVazio() .Or. Ctb080Form()
Moeda do fato contábil para a entidade Débito. Esse campo deverá ser preenchido caso deseje que essa operação seja considerada para o cálculo da variação cambial utilizando a rotina de variação.
CT5_CODFOR200CCód. Fornec.Código do FornecedorVazio() .Or. Ctb080Form()
Informe o código do fornecedor. Apenas para vinculo e informação. Campo mantido por compatibilidade, descontinuado não é mais utilizado nos demais módulos.
CT5_MOEFCR100CMoed fato CRMoeda do fato p/ a ent CRVazio() .Or. Ctb080Form()
Moeda do fato contábil para a entidade Crédito. Esse campo deverá ser preenchido caso deseje que essa operação seja considerada para o cálculo da variação cambial utilizando a rotina de variação.
CT5_OBS255MObs. Lcto.Observações do Lançamento
Registre aqui o detalhe do lançamento, assim como as instruções para alteração que possam ser uteis para o próximo usuário a dar manutenção no lançamento
CT5_CTAREC1CCta ReceitaConta de ReceitaPertence("1|2|3")
Indica se o lançamento contábil gerado possuirá a conta de receita principal e se estará no campo de débito ou crédito, esta informação será utilizada na geração do EFD-Contribuições.

Relacionamentos

Tabela DestinoExpressão OrigemExpressão Destino
CTLCT5_LANPADCTL_LP
CV3CT5_LANPAD+CT5_SEQUENCV3_LP+CV3_LPSEQ
CVICT5_LANPAD+CT5_SEQUENCVI_LANPAD+CVI_SEQLAN
SRVCT5_LANPADRV_LCTOP